Guy was suggesting uncommenting the first \score section down the
bottom. In that case there is all sorts of strange stuff going on. It
looks like the \oneVoice / \stemNeutral commands (which are directed
at the full score) are being picked up by the reduction.

The attached modified file uses \tag to remove all voice indications
in the reduction, and seems to work. Rests in the divisi sections are
problematic, but I’m not sure where I’d put them myself, let alone
getting Lilypond to guess...
